Deaundra is a unisex name. It is given to both girls and boys — about 73% of recorded births with this name are girls. In 2009 it was given to 5 babies in the United States. It was given to fewer than five babies in the most recent year of published US data.

  • Peaked in 1992, when 34 babies were given the name.
  • It has largely dropped out of use.
  • First appears in US birth records in 1970.

How popular is Deaundra?

In 2009, Deaundra was given to 5 babies in the United States. It was given to fewer than five babies in the most recent year of published US data.

US figures omit any name given to fewer than five babies in a year, so the rarest names are absent from the source rather than absent from use. Data & sources.
